How much do secure software developer j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 26, 2026, the average yearly pay for secure software developer in Foxboro, MA is $118,387.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$95,300.00 and $137,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Secure Software Develop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Secure Software Developer, you need strong programming abilities, a solid understanding of cybersecurity principles, and experience with secure coding practices, often sup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with tools like static code analyzers, vulnerability scanners, and security frameworks, as well as certifications such as CSSLP or CEH, are commonly required. Attention to detail, problem-solving, and effective communication are vital soft skills in this role. These skills and qualifications are crucial to building resilient software and protecting organizations from evolving security threats.

What is a Secure Software Developer?

A Secure Software Developer is a professional who designs, develops, and maintains software with a focus on security. Their role involves implementing best practices and security protocols to protect applications from vulnerabilities and cyber threats. They collaborate with other developers, security experts, and stakeholders to ensure that security is integrated throughout the software development lifecycle. Secure Software Developers also perform code reviews, threat modeling, and stay updated on emerging security risks to create robust and safe applications.

What are some common challenges Secure Software Developers face when integrating security into the software development lifecycle?

Secure Software Developers often encounter challenges such as balancing application performance with security controls, keeping up with constantly evolving threats, and ensuring secure coding practices are consistently followed across development teams. They must also work closely with other developers, QA testers, and DevOps professionals to implement security requirements without slowing down project timelines. Regular code reviews, automated security testing, and ongoing collaboration with stakeholders are essential to overcoming these challenges and delivering robust, secure software.

Job description

Who We Are:
At Emburse, you'll not just imagine the future - you'll build it. As a leader in travel and expense solutions, we are creating a future where technology drives business value and inspires extraordinary results. Our AI-powered platform helps organizations modernize financial operations, increase visibility, and optimize spend across the enterprise.
Emburse software engineers contribute to the development of an engaging and interconnected set of system solutions. As an engineer, you will enhance the experiences of your customers, solve interesting challenges, and design new solutions. Emburse, known for its innovation and award-winning technologies, is strong on engineering. This ensures you will have access to the best and brightest minds in our industry to grow your experience and career within Emburse.
What you will do :
  • Technical
  • Self-sufficient in at least one large area of the codebase
  • Mastery of at least one language and developing mastery of multiple other languages, frameworks and tools
  • Identifies viable alternative solutions and presents them
  • Understanding of relational databases, development frameworks, and commonly used industry libraries.
  • Understanding of testing and integration testing techniques
  • Moderate understanding of how a handful of key sub-systems interoperate
  • Ability to read and understand existing code and offer recommendations for improvement
  • Understanding of OWASP

  • Process
  • SDLC processes are followed, including adopting agile-based processes/meetings, peer code-reviews, and technical preparations required for scheduled releases.
  • Understands product roadmap and how one contributes to the overall objectives
  • Capability of prioritizing tasks
  • Estimates their own work
  • Learns and applies secure software development practices, reviews code for vulnerabilities and raises awareness of secure programming practices

  • Impact
  • Fixes bugs of moderate complexity and demonstrates proficient debugging skills
  • Reviews code for team members, providing in-depth comments
  • Develops new features or enhancements with minimal supervision
  • Delivers medium level refactoring
  • Implements unit testing and integration testing where needed
  • Produces quality technical documentation
  • Makes technical documentation/knowledge base contributions and technical team presentations

  • Communication
  • Gives constructive feedback to team members
  • Understanding of industry jargon and business concepts
  • Raises roadblocks and updates estimations as needed

What we are looking for :
  • Required: Bachelor's degree in Computer Science or related field, or equivalent years' experience
  • Required: Minimum of 8 years of experience in software engineering
  • Experience with C# in a distributed web application development environment (e.g. microservices, APIs, DB integration, queues, topics, caches, containers, serverless)
  • Experience with Azure services and APIs, or equivalent cloud vendor experience
  • Experience working in Windows and Linux environments
  • Experience designing and building REST services and APIs
  • Experience with source control such as Git
  • Experience with CI/CD pipelines and deployment methodologies
  • Experience working in an Agile software development environment (e.g. scrum)
  • Experience working with 3rd party APIs, workflow and integration architectures
  • Experience with large-scale or distributed web applications
  • Desirable: Experience with data processing or data engineering, integration with AI and ML services, APIs or models.
  • Desirable: Experience working in the travel domain
